These are the dried, star-shaped flowers of the Mimusops elengi tree, also known as Bakul. They are famous for their long-lasting, subtle fragrance and are often used in garlands.

Growing Fruit and Flowers in Mumbai
Gardening in a city like Mumbai brings unique challenges, particularly regarding space and sunlight. We recommend fragrant plants like Kavathi Chafa (Magnolia) and Bakul (Mimusops elengi) for balconies with at least four to five hours of direct sunlight. These shrubs do not just look good; they add a natural fragrance to your home that no synthetic freshener can match.

Practical Care Tips
- Sunlight: Most of our flowering shrubs need consistent sunlight to bloom. Check your balcony orientation before selecting.
- Fertilizer: Use our slow-release flowering boosters during the growing season to ensure consistent blooms.
- Watering: Proper drainage is critical. Our setup includes specific drainage layers to prevent root rot in heavy monsoon conditions.
